Bitcoin Layer 2 Network Bitlayer Labs Raises $5M in Seed Round, Backed by Framework Ventures, ABCDE Capital and StarkWare

Bitlayer Labs, the first Bitcoin Layer 2 solution based on BitVM, announced a seed round of $5M led by Framework Ventures and ABCDE Capital, participation by StarkWare, OKX Ventures, Alliance DAO, UTXO Management, Asymmetric Capital and many more. The announcement comes as Bitlayer prepares the launch of its open-incentive program Ready Player One, inviting developers worldwide to augment, enhance, and build on the protocol.

March 27th, 2024 — Bitlayer Labs, the developer of Bitcoin Layer 2 protocol Bitlayer, announced today the close of a $5 million seed funding round at an $80 million valuation, driving a vision to become the computation layer of Bitcoin.

The Bitlayer Network

Bitlayer is the first Bitcoin Layer 2 network based on BitVM, offering Bitcoin-equivalent security and Turing-completeness. The protocol aims to build a more scalable and interconnected Bitcoin ecosystem.

The securing of new capital pushes Bitlayer’s lead in paving the way for more Bitcoin Layer 2 use cases, a race that will propel Bitcoin to prevail over other blockchains in size, scalability, and security. The fund will also enable Bitlayer to grow its team by hiring across business development and engineering faculties to support global expansion efforts.

Investor Remarks

Roy Learner, partner at Framework Ventures, spoke on the augmentation of Bitlayer with BitVM:

“We are excited to back Bitlayer as they launch the first Bitcoin Layer 2 network based on BitVM. Looking at the trade-off space, BitVM struck us as the most practical approach to bring scalability and expressiveness into the BTC ecosystem without sacrificing security. With over $1T of global wealth looking to productively utilize their BTC, Bitlayer opens up the design space to introduce novel DeFi use cases and applications. Led by a team of OGs, we’ve been impressed by Kevin and Charlie’s blend of deep technical background and rich crypto experience and are excited to partner with them as they deliver on their vision of making Bitcoin a more productive asset.”

Qiao Wang, co-founder of Alliance DAO, emphasized the future of Bitlayer and Bitcoin L2s in the emerging era:

“I spent the vast majority of my intellectual, social, and financial capital in the Ethereum ecosystem in the last decade, but deep down I’ve always been a Bitcoiner. The possibility to enhance Bitcoin’s expressiveness and scalability via L2s such as Bitlayer is the most exciting moment in the history of Bitcoin. That is because there’s over $1T of wealth stored on Bitcoin, and the holders would want to do something productive with it. Greater expressiveness and scalability enable this. Bitlayer is one of the most experienced, passionate, and technically capable teams to tackle this problem.”

ABCDE Capital co-founder and managing partner BMAN Lee expressed his convictions on Bitlayer and the prospects of the Bitcoin L2 landscape:

“Fisher’s equation, MV = PQ, stands steadfast in our crypto zeitgeist: the money in circulation (M), its velocity (V), the price of goods (P), and the quantity of assets (Q). Up until now, M has been constant, and V has been very low, limiting the scale of asset quantities and asset prices on the right side of the equation. The requisite for Bitcoin L2s is then made clear, to accelerate the velocity of Bitcoin. Bitlayer’s mission is to become Bitcoin’s computing layer, security-equivalent with Layer 1 and a paragon of efficiency, security, and scalability. Founders Charlie Hu and Kevin He, with their seasoned expertise, unwavering passion, and formidable technical prowess are thrust to the forefront of the Bitcoin L2 ecosystem. The founders’ commitment to overcoming the challenge of Bitcoin scalability heralds a new era of possibility.”

About Bitlayer

Bitlayer is the first Bitcoin Layer 2 network based on BitVM, offering Bitcoin-equivalent security and Turing-completeness. Bitlayer is committed to becoming the computation layer for Bitcoin. It introduces ultra-scalability and inherits Bitcoin’s L1 security, providing users with high throughput and a low-cost transaction experience.
